Brookie Cookies

Serving size:

  • Around 14 cookies

Ingredients:

Cookie part

  • 3/4 cup butter, softened

  • 3/4 cup brown sugar

  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ar

  • 1 egg

  • 2 tsp vanilla

  • 1 1/2 cup All-purpose flour

  • 1 tsp baking soda

  • 3/4 cup chocolate chips

Brownie part

  • 3/4 cup butter, softened

  • 3/4 brown sugar

  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ar

  • 1 egg

  • 2 tsp vanilla

  • 1 1/4 cup All-purpose flour

  • 1/4 cup cocoa powder

  • 1 tsp baking soda

  • 1 tsp espresso powder

  • 3/4 cup chocolate chips

Instructions

Step 1

  • Preheat oven to 350F (180C). Line a baking pan with parchment paper and set aside.

Step 2

  • Cookie part: Beat butter until it’s fluffy or turns an off-white colour (about 3 minutes).

Step 3

  • Add in brown sugar and granulated sugar and mix until fluffy (about 2 minutes).

Step 4

  • Add the egg and vanilla extract and mix well.

Step 5

  • Add the flour, and baking soda. Mix until a soft dough forms. Then add the chocolate chips. Mix until combined.

Step 6

  • Brownie part: Beat butter until it’s fluffy or turns an off-white colour (about 3 minutes).

Step 7

  • Add in brown sugar and granulated sugar and mix until fluffy (about 2 minutes).

Step 8

  • Add the egg and vanilla extract and mix well.

Step 9

  • Add the fl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and espresso powder. Mix until a soft dough forms. Then add the chocolate chips. Mix until combined.

Step 10

  • Use a 0.5 ounce cookie scoop to scoop from the cookie part and brownie part. Add both cookie parts together. Bake for 11 - 13 minutes, or until the edges are slightly golden.
